Bottom Line

The 96-room Super 8 New Orleans is a typical roadside value hotel. With its proximity to the freeway, it's ideal for anyone who's on a road trip or about to hop on a cruise. The price is good and there's a small fitness room, pool, and free breakfast. That said, the location is less than ideal for tourists, as it's not near the airport or French Quarter, and there's little of interest within walking distance. If you want a quick highway stop or are on a strict budget this hotel is a good option, but if you are looking to be immersed in the bustle of NOLA, you'll have better luck in the French Quarter -- though you'll pay more, even for a budget chain hotel like the Four Points by Sheraton French Quarter.

Oyster Hotel Review

Super 8 by Wyndham New Orleans

Scene

Basic chain roadside property with a few muggy areas that trap unpleasant smells

This Super 8 New Orleans has some pretty grim immediate surroundings: a closed interstate off-ramp, an abandoned hotel property next door, and an RV park on the other side. It's just a typical roadside motel with few amenities and unremarkable decor. The hotel can get hot and humid in the semi-outdoor hallways (especially on the third floor) and some guests have complained of food and cigarette smells. However, the main areas in the front of the building are air conditioned and fully enclosed. Overall, the vibe is casual, with guests either smoking or talking on cell phones by the pool or in the outdoor hallways. Some of the renovated rooms give the hotel a slightly updated vibe.

Location

Next to the I-10 freeway in a lackluster area, 15-minute walk from the French Quarter

Located off of exit 240 of the I-10 freeway, this hotel is in a no man's land. It's surrounded by rundown buildings and out-of-business hotels and shops so there isn't much of note nearby. NOLA's city center is a 20-minute drive away and the French Quarter is only a few minutes closer. While there is public transportation into town, it requires multiple changes and a typical journey time of 45-minutes or more. Getting to the airport takes over two hours by bus, and around 30 minutes by car. The cruise port is just a 10-minute drive away.

Rooms

Basic rooms (some renovated) with mini-fridges, microwaves, and balconies

At the time of our visit, only some of the rooms were renovated, with updated decor, furniture, and bedspreads, and large photographs of the French Quarter. Despite these upgrades, the motel remains a basic value property. Comfy beds, mini-fridges, tea and coffee makers, and tube-style TVs are standard in all rooms. Some also have microwaves and balconies of varying sizes. Bathrooms are of the standard value hotel variety, but are clean and come with hairdryers, shampoo, and soap. Suites have living rooms with pull-out sofa beds.

Features

Basic value hotel features with a nice size pool and free parking

As it's a basic value motel, the Super 8 New Orleans doesn't have any luxury features, but guests will find a decent-sized, clean, outdoor pool set within a fairly pleasant courtyard area. Poolside seating is restricted to tables and chairs. There's also a small gym with a few cardio machines and a weight machine, and while the one-computer business center is nothing to email home about, it does have a printer. A breakfast of waffles, cereal, juice, cinnamon rolls, and fruit is free for all guests, and free coffee is available all day in the lobby. A coin-operated laundry facility with two washers and two dryers is available on-site. The hotel has free parking, including long-term parking for returning guests, which is a nice perk for those heading out on cruises.
